Why alcohol withdrawal can transform dangerous

Heavy alcohol consumption reduces specific excitatory systems in the brain while boosting repressive effects. In time, the nerves compensates. Once alcohol is removed, the brakes come off, and the brain can become over active. That overactivity shows up in signs such as sweating, trembling, nausea or vomiting, anxiousness, sleeping disorders, raised pulse, and boosted blood pressure. In more extreme instances, it can result in hallucinations, seizures, or delirium tremens.

The public often tends to find out about the typical signs and not the escalation threat. A person may inform family members, "I'm simply unsteady," while neglecting the auto racing heart, increasing panic, or failure to keep fluids down. Households might interpret confusion as fatigue instead of an indication. Timing includes in the issue. Some withdrawal signs begin within hours, while others peak later on. The person who seems secure on day one can aggravate on day two or three.

Delirium tremens is not the most common outcome, however it is severe sufficient that it shapes clinical decision-making. It can include severe agitation, disorientation, high temperature, dazzling hallucinations, and harmful cardio pressure. Untreated, it can be fatal. That is why monitored alcohol detox exists. It is not concerning convenience alone. It is about reducing preventable harm.

What managed detoxification usually includes

The specifics vary by center and by individual demand, yet many clinical detoxification programs share an usual framework. The aim is to maintain the person risk-free while the body adapts to the absence of alcohol.

Monitoring is main. Vitals are inspected regularly, especially in the very early phase when withdrawal signs and symptoms can alter promptly. Personnel expect tremblings, sweating, anxiety, rest disturbance, gastrointestinal distress, complication, and changes in orientation. A person who appears merely nervous might really be going into an extra challenging withdrawal pattern, and tiny shifts can matter.

Medication might be utilized when scientifically indicated. The specific approach depends on the person's presentation, health account, and supplier judgment, yet the broad function is uncomplicated: to decrease withdrawal extent and lower the danger of significant problems. Detox should never ever feel like improvisation. It should feel measured.

Hydration and nourishment additionally are worthy of even more focus than they obtain. Individuals going into alcohol detox are commonly dehydrated, reduced in electrolytes, and undernourished. Some have actually hardly consumed. Others have been resting improperly for weeks. Restoring fluids, sustaining food consumption, and resolving deficiencies are not cosmetic touches. They support mind feature, cardio stability, and overall recovery capacity.

Then there is the psychological side. Withdrawal can multiply fear. Clients may really feel trapped in their very own bodies, particularly if stress and anxiety, sweating, nausea or vomiting, and insomnia all struck at once. Calm, experienced team make a real distinction below. A consistent voice, clear expectations, and prompt sign reaction can protect against panic from feeding the withdrawal process.

Signs that detox need to not be done alone

There is no benefit in claiming home detox is safe for everyone. For some individuals with extremely light signs and symptoms and low-risk backgrounds, outpatient monitoring may be scientifically proper with proper oversight. But many people ignore their danger, especially if they aspire to prevent treatment.

These circumstances often direct towards professional evaluation instead of trying to white-knuckle withdrawal in your home:

  1. Daily heavy alcohol consumption over an extended period, especially if morning alcohol consumption is involved.
  2. A background of withdrawal symptoms such as trembles, hallucinations, seizures, or severe agitation.
  3. Co-occurring medical or psychiatric problems, consisting of high blood pressure, liver concerns, panic signs and symptoms, or self-destructive thinking.
  4. Use of various other materials or drugs that make complex withdrawal and monitoring.
  5. A home setting where alcohol is easily available or where no reliable grownup can assist observe alerting signs.

Even when none of these are evident, an expert assessment is still sensible. Alcohol withdrawal has a method of humbling people who think they can predict it.

How long do alcohol withdrawal symptoms last in Palm Beach Gardens?

Alcohol withdrawal symptoms typically begin within 6 to 24 hours after the last drink. Symptoms often peak between 24 and 72 hours and improve within 5 to 7 days. Some people experience prolonged symptoms, such as sleep disturbances or anxiety, for several weeks. The duration varies based on drinking history and overall health.

What are the stages of alcohol withdrawal in Palm Beach Gardens?

Alcohol withdrawal generally progresses through three stages. Early symptoms include anxiety, sweating, nausea, and tremors within the first 24 hours. More severe symptoms, such as hallucinations or seizures, may occur within 24 to 72 hours in some individuals. Symptoms usually improve after several days, although lingering effects can persist.
